Just hours before the PlayStation 4’s European release, Sony has announced that it’s temporarily turning off some of the console’s features to ensure a smooth experience for consumers. “Following the successful launch of PS4 in North America on the 15th November, we have seen an unprecedented influx of players onto PSN,” the company posted on its European blog today. “When we launch in Europe on Friday, once again, we are expecting record sales and record numbers of people logging onto PSN at similar times, alongside the North American players already on PSN.” Following PS4’s American debut, the PlayStation Network experienced service interruptions and various other issues thanks to the increased traffic.
